Past Simple
Je gebruikt de Past Simple om aan te geven dat iets in het verleden is gebeurd en toen ook is afgerond. Het is een feit over het verleden. Bv gisteren fietste ik naar school.
Je krijgt in het Engels dan als vorm:
WW+ED of het 2e rijtje van de onregelmatige werkwoorden.
I cycled to school yesterday.
He bought flowers for his wife last weekend.
3
Spellingsuitzonderingen (1)
Werkwoorden die eindigen op -e, krijgen alleen -d erachter:
- to bake: We baked a delicious cake yesterday.
Werkwoorden die eindigen op -c, krijgen -ked erachter:
- to panic: She panicked when she heard the bad news.
Werkwoorden die eindigen op -y, met een medeklinker ervoor, krijgen -ied:
- to marry: She married him when she was 18 years old.

Uitzondering op alles
Het werkwoord to be heeft zijn eigen vormen in de verleden tijd.
I was
he was
she was
it was
we were
you were
they were
In het kort: enkelvoud krijgt WAS, meervoud krijgt WERE

Vragen maken
Vragen maken in de verleden tijd doe je met DID. Deze zet je vooraan de vraag neer.
Let op! Het werkwoord is dan weer het hele werkwoord, omdat DID al in de verleden tijd staat!
He bought flowers for his wife. --> Did he buy flowers for his wife?
Als er was/were in de zin staat, mag daar wel een vraag mee gemaakt worden.
He was working hard. --> Was he working hard?
6
Ontkenningen maken
Ontkenningen maken in de Past Simple lijkt op vragen maken. Je gebruikt didn't voor het hele werkwoord.
He made his homework. --> He didn't make his homework.
Bij was/were mag je er gewoon not achter zetten!
He was happy. --> He wasn't happy.

Wanneer gebruiken we de Present Perfect?
We gebruiken de Present Perfect om over acties te praten die in het verleden begonnen zijn en nu nog bezig/merkbaar.
De signaalwoorden zijn:
since / for/ always/ never/ ever/ just/ yet/ already/ how long

The difference
Do you know the difference between:
We've painted the room and We've been painting the room?
Look at these examples to see how the present perfect simple and continuous are used.
We've painted the bathroom.
She's been training for a half-marathon.
I've had three coffees already today!
They've been waiting for hours.
12
Wat is het verschil?
Present perfect simple | Present perfect continuous |
Focuses on the result | Focuses on the activity |
You've cleaned the bathroom! It looks lovely! | I've been gardening. It's so nice out there. |
Says 'how many' | Says 'how long' |
She's read ten books this summer. | She's been reading that book all day. |
Describes a completed action | Describes an activity which may continue |
I've written you an email. | I've been writing emails. |
| When we can see evidence of recent activity |
| The grass looks wet. Has it been raining? |
